The Huawei Nova 13 is a high-end smartphone that exemplifies Huawei's commitment to pushing the boundaries of technology and innovation. Announced in October 2024, it is set to be released later in the month. The Huawei Nova 13 supports a wide range of network technologies including GSM, CDMA, HSPA, CDMA2000, LTE, and 5G. This ensures seamless connectivity across various regions and carriers. The device supports 2G, 3G, 4G, and 5G bands, allowing for high-speed internet access and reliable connections. The integration of 5G technology provides faster download speeds and improved connectivity, making it suitable for streaming, gaming, and downloading large files.
With dimensions of 161.4 x 75.3 x 7 mm and weighing just 195 g, the Huawei Nova 13 offers a comfortable and sleek design that's easy to handle. It features a Dual SIM (Nano-SIM, dual stand-by) capability, allowing users to manage multiple numbers effectively. The device is available in an array of elegant colors, including Black, White, Purple, and Green, catering to diverse tastes.
The device boasts a stunning 6.7-inch OLED display with a resolution of 1084 x 2412 pixels. The screen-to-body ratio is approximately 89.1%, providing an immersive viewing experience. The display supports 1 billion colors, HDR, and a 120Hz refresh rate, ensuring vibrant colors and smooth transitions. Protected by aluminosilicate glass, the display is both durable and visually striking.
The Huawei Nova 13 runs on HarmonyOS 4.2, which offers a smooth and intuitive user experience. Storage options for the Huawei Nova 13 include 256GB, 512GB, and 1TB, providing ample space for apps, media, and files. The device, however, does not support expandable storage via a microSD card slot. The dual main camera setup includes a 50 MP wide lens with an f/1.9 aperture and an 8 MP ultrawide lens with an f/2.2 aperture. This combination provides versatility for capturing high-quality images in various lighting conditions. The camera features laser autofocus, LED flash, panorama, and HDR capabilities for enhanced image capturing. Video recording is supported at 4K and 1080p resolutions with gyro-EIS for stability.
The front camera is a single 60 MP ultrawide lens with an f/2.4 aperture. It supports HDR and panorama features, ensuring that selfies look vibrant and clear. Video capabilities include 4K@30fps and 1080p@30fps with gyro-EIS, allowing for high-quality video calls and vlogging.
The Huawei Nova 13 comes equipped with loudspeakers but does not include a 3.5mm headphone jack, indicating a wireless audio solution. This might encourage users to utilize wireless earbuds or headphones, offering convenience and a sleek audio experience.
Connectivity is a strong suit for the Nova 13. It supports Wi-Fi 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ac/6 with dual-band and Wi-Fi Direct, ensuring high-speed internet access. Bluetooth 5.2 is available for pairing with various devices, offering features like A2DP and LE for efficient audio transmission. Positioning technologies include GPS, GALILEO, GLONASS, BDS, and QZSS, providing accurate and reliable navigation.
For added functionality, the device is equipped with NFC, which facilitates easy payment solutions and data transfer. An infrared port is also included, allowing the phone to be used as a remote control for various appliances.
The Huawei Nova 13 is powered by a sizable 5000 mAh non-removable battery, ensuring long-lasting power to get through the day. The phone supports 100W wired charging, capable of charging from 3% to 50% in just 10 minutes as advertised. This rapid charging capability is complemented by 5W reverse wired charging, offering convenience for powering other devices.
An array of sensors are available on the Nova 13, including a fingerprint sensor under the display (optical), accelerometer, gyro, compass, and color spectrum sensor. These features enhance user experience through security, motion detection, and precise environmental awareness.
